    Mmmm, well I did it a few weeks ago (first time) and sunset was around 9, got down just as it was getting dark, BUT had major puncture on the way down. We came down rangers, which is much better than the Llanberis path and then telegraph road, which is where I had punctures, the water bars ripped a hole in my tubeless tires, which caused no end of issues.

    Once down rangers, telegraph road would be good fun with lights.

    It is roughly two hours climb if walking, but a lot of it is rideable.

    Its better in the morning, that way on the ride down people walking up are facing you and tend to move out of the way. In the evening people are walking down.
